Deal Details
Select Micro Center Stores have AMD Ryzen 7 7800X3D + ASUS B650-E TUF Mobo + 32GB G.Skill Flare X5 DDR5-6000 RAM on sale for $499.99. Select free store pickup only where stock permits/available.
  • Note: Availability for store pickup may vary by location. Offer valid for in-store pickup option only; usually within 18 minutes of ordering.
Thanks to Deal Hunter tDames for sharing this deal.

Includes:
  • AMD Ryzen 7 7800X3D Raphael AM5 4.2GHz 8-Core Boxed Processor
  • ASUS B650-E TUF Gaming WiFi AMD AM5 ATX Motherboard
  • G.Skill Flare X5 Series 32GB (2 x 16GB) DDR5-6000 PC5-48000 CL36 Dual Channel Desktop Memory Kit
Available Upgrades (see bundle build page for details):
  • 32GB (2 x 16GB) Corsair Vengeance RGB DDR5-6000 CL36 Dual Channel Desktop Memory $514.99
  • 64GB (2 x 32GB) Corsair Vengeance RGB DDR5-6000 CL30 Dual Channel Desktop Memory $639.99
  • 4TB Samsung 9100 PRO PCIe Gen 5 Solid State Drive + 32GB (2 x 16GB) Corsair Vengeance RGB DDR5-6000 CL36 Dual Channel Desktop Memory = $914.98

It has been this price at least for a month. It was as low as $450 last year. It slowly crept up upon the launch of the 7600X3D bundle (9/24). After the 7600X3D bundle launched at $450, the 7800X3D bundle shot up to $600. This bundle should be $440 or $450 considering the 7600X3D bundle is $400. If buying the CPU alone there's only a $40 difference between the $300 7600X3D and $340 7800X3D at Micro Center right now. With the 9600X3D coming soon and the 9950X3D bundle for $800 at the high end, I expect this will push the 7800X3D/9800X3D bundles down a little more.

Buyers beware the microcenter 4tb nvme is severely overpriced.

You can find 4tb nvme regularly for $200.

The extra $140 for 64gb ram cl 30 is good if it was $140 total. However paying an additional $140 on top of the $100 or so for the cheap 32gb of ram is also overpriced.

A good 64gb kit is roughly $220 so you are paying roughly $240 for this 64gb. Thankfully it's cl30 so its not a terrible deal, but still bit overpriced.

This isn't a real bundle deal unless the 64gb cl30 came with it at $500. The 32gb is a slow cl36 so you wouldn't want that.

Cl28 is the best right now and those are $120 for 32gb.

I think the 7600x3d for $400 and buying 32 cl28 ram for $120 coming to $520 before u sell the crappy 32gb cl36 ram is the best deal if you have to buy a gaming x3d cpu right now.

I would pass on this deal unless the 32gb ram was at least cl30. But they are putting crappy cl36 and overpricing the 64gb.

edit:

after bundling the 64gb kit, it's actually lowered to $223 and for the fastest cl30 speed this is a good deal. but only if u need 64gb. otherwise you won't get much for the slow 32gb cl36 kit. this would be a slick deal if it was $450 making the 64gb kit $590 or so....

either way not great deals since I got my 7950x3d with 32gb cl30 for $600 last year.

seems there is a inflation on parts still right now.

I bought this bundle back in May, the only real downside is the motherboard. It's slow to post (even on the latest bios), and lacks some nice to haves such as heatsinks for secondary m.2 slots and is 'just' wifi 6e. Very solid combo, ram being cl36 also isn't that big of a deal.
